RSS office petrol bomb attack: NIA cracks down
RANCHI: The National Investigation Agency (NIA), carried out coordinated raids at multiple locations in Jharkhand’s Lohardaga district as part of its ongoing investigation into the petrol bomb attack on the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S) provincial office in Ranchi in June. The NIA has intensified its investigation into the petrol bomb attack on the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S) state office in Ranchi. Early Thursday morning, the NIA team raided the Lohardaga residence of the jailed main accused, Saif Ansari, and Aman Ansari, along with several other suspected locations.
